Window safety devices in Strata: install by 13 March 2018

Do you live in, own or manage a townhouse or unit block? To prevent children falling from windows, strata schemes must have window safety devices installed on all applicable windows by 13 March 2018. This applies to openable windows where the internal floor is more than 2m above the surface outside and within a child’s reach (less than 1.7m above the inside floor) – see the diagram below….
